Output 34c8f5ad318729bfd9d04496b0305fde9d08109bafded4fc82e951d2ff09b154:2

value
511604
script pubkey
OP_0 OP_PUSHBYTES_20 b267368fcc7eefc61f25f07b3529b9998219ca22
address
bc1qkfnndr7v0mhuv8e97pan22denxppnj3z8gnmu9
transaction
34c8f5ad318729bfd9d04496b0305fde9d08109bafded4fc82e951d2ff09b154
confirmations
171027
spent
true